Abstract
Type typology,number and distribution pattern of antennal sensilla were studied in the weevil Eucryptorrhynchus chinenis(Olivier)(Coleoptera,Curculionidae)with scanning electron microscopy.The results showed that there were 5 types and 10 kinds of sensilla,comprising 4 kinds of basiconic sensilla,2 kinds of chaetica sensilla,2 kinds of trichoid sensilla,1 kind of styloconica sensilla and 1 kind of cylindric sensilla.The possible functions were discussed on the basis of the distribution,shape character of sensilla as well as the correlative references.Quantity and distribution of sensilla were different in each segment of antenna.No remarkable difference in the type,number and distribution of antennal sensilla on the antennal dorsal and ventral areas as found.There were remarkable sexual differences in total number of antennal sensilla.
